How to Ensure Business Continuity during Uncertain Times


In today’s ever-changing business landscape, it is crucial for organizations to have a solid plan in place to ensure business continuity during uncertain times. Whether it’s a natural disaster, a global pandemic, or economic upheaval, having a plan in place can help companies weather the storm and emerge stronger on the other side.

Here are some key strategies to ensure business continuity during uncertain times:

1. Develop a comprehensive business continuity plan: The first step in ensuring business continuity is to develop a comprehensive plan that outlines how the organization will respond to various disruptions. This plan should include protocols for communication, employee safety, remote work arrangements, and supply chain management.

2. Conduct regular risk assessments: It’s important to regularly assess potential risks and vulnerabilities to the business. This can help identify areas of weakness and allow for proactive measures to be put in place to mitigate risks before they become crises.

3. Implement remote work policies: In today’s digital age, remote work has become increasingly common. Having policies and procedures in place for remote work can help ensure that business operations can continue uninterrupted, even in the face of uncertainty.

4. Maintain strong communication channels: Communication is key during uncertain times. It’s important to keep employees, customers, and stakeholders informed about any developments and changes to business operations. This can help build trust and confidence in the organization’s ability to navigate challenging times.

5. Diversify supply chains: Relying on a single supplier or vendor can leave a business vulnerable to disruptions. Diversifying supply chains can help mitigate risks and ensure that the organization can continue to operate even if one supplier is unable to fulfill orders.

6. Invest in technology: Technology can play a crucial role in ensuring business continuity. Investing in cloud-based systems, cybersecurity measures, and remote communication tools can help organizations adapt to changing circumstances and maintain operations during uncertain times.

7. Train employees: Employees are a company’s most valuable asset. Training employees on business continuity protocols and procedures can help ensure that everyone is prepared to respond effectively in the event of a disruption.

By following these strategies, organizations can better prepare for uncertain times and ensure business continuity even in the face of challenges. Taking proactive steps to plan for disruptions can help companies navigate uncertain times with resilience and agility, ultimately emerging stronger on the other side.
